Transaction 26ed89a360fc1d7d459db6584076b07cb00df9dc5b28a0ae12e3c3169ce9f8e4
1 Input
1 Output
-
26ed89a360fc1d7d459db6584076b07cb00df9dc5b28a0ae12e3c3169ce9f8e4:0
- value
- 1290759
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ba5fdfccac50dd5c54e4631e7bd8684f41b2ec2
- address
- bc1qdwjlmlx2c5xat32wgcc700vxsn6pktkzr548pm